Original Description
Thomas Shotter Boys' Le Quai De Grève Et Le Pont D'Arcole is a captivating 19th-century lithograph that masterfully captures the romantic charm of Paris along the Seine. Created around 1833, the work reflects the artist's meticulous attention to architectural detail and atmospheric effects, blending the precision of topographical accuracy with a poetic sensibility. Boys was celebrated for his ability to depict cityscapes with both historical fidelity and artistic flair, playing a key role in popularizing lithography as a fine art medium. This particular piece, part of his acclaimed series Picturesque Architecture in Paris, Ghent, Antwerp, Rouen, highlights the Gothic and classical elements of the Hôtel de Ville and the iron-trussed Pont d’Arcole, bathed in soft daylight. The scene’s tranquil yet lively mood—enhanced by scattered figures and the play of light on water—positions it as a quintessential example of Romantic-era urban landscapes, bridging documentary precision and emotive storytelling.
